Mikel Makes Cameo Appearance As Chelsea Beat Arsenal
Published: September 19, 2015
John Obi Mikel made a cameo appearance as Chelsea beat Arsenal 2- 0 in a London derby on Saturday afternoon.
With the three point secured, manager Jose Mourinho introduced the defensive midfielder two minutes into stoppage time as a replacement for Cesc Fabregas.
Saturday’s appearance at Stamford Bridge was Mikel’s 62nd game as substitute in the Premier League since he debuted in the 2006 - 2007 season.
Kurt Zouma opened scoring for the defending champs 8 minutes out of intermission before Eden Hazard’s injury time strike.
The victory against Arsenal has brought Chelsea’s points total to 7 points and 10th position in the provisional standings.
